
Replacement of a Lost, Stolen or Damaged Card and Driver's Licence
To have your Health Insurance Card and Driver's Licence renewed at the same time, you must follow the authentication process so that an authenticating official can verify your identity.
The same photo will be used for both cards.
What to do

Only the photo taken at the service outlet can be used.
You will be asked to sign the authentication document in the presence of an authenticating official, who will send the Régie the information necessary for producing your Health Insurance Card.
Fee
A fee of $15 is charged for replacement of a Health Insurance Card. However, persons age 65 or over and recipients of last-resort financial assistance are exempt from paying this fee.
The SAAQ will also charge a fee for taking your photo and replacing your Driver's Licence.
Receipt of your card
The Régie will mail you a new card if you are still eligible for the Health Insurance Plan. In its Statement of Services for the Public, the Régie
undertakes to issue your card
within 14 days.
If you are awaiting receipt of your card and require healthcare, please contact the Régie.
If other cards, licences or documents of yours have been lost or stolen, consult the Québec government website to find out how to have them replaced.
